Timeline
Perfect tenses are used whenever we are talking about a point in time before another point in time.
Past Perfect Use for an action that happened in the past before another action. e.g. - I had already eaten breakfast when my brother arrived. |
Present Perfect Use for an action that happened in the past before the present moment. e.g. - I have already eaten breakfast. |
Future Perfect Use for an action that will happen in the future before another action. e.g. - I will have already eaten breakfast by the time my brothers arrives. |
